**Ticket: Per-tenant rate quotas bypassed on the Fennbrook gateway.** When a tenant rotates credentials mid-window, the quota counter resets because the bucket key derives from the credential rather than the tenant identifier. A motivated tenant can rotate repeatedly and exceed their allocation by an order of magnitude, starving neighbors on shared capacity. Fix proposed: key buckets on the stable tenant record. Security review requested before merge given abuse potential. Reproduction run output ends with the trace token shown directly below.

pipeline stamp: htk31_f769b577b3028a4e9958e5bb8d1259a

# Quillstream Environments

Quillstream runs in three environments: dev, staging, and prod, each with its own log pipeline. The `qtail` CLI is the supported way to tail logs; direct node access is deprecated as of the Harrowgate release. `qtail` resolves the target environment from its active profile, so release managers should verify the profile before a cut. Staging mirrors prod topology but retains logs for only 48 hours. The CLI reads its environment settings at startup, and the current staging values are shown below.

deployment values, bahof-badug:
[rusix]
team = zorok
access_code = ac_641cbe
owner = ulair.tamius
host = rusix.torvasoft.local
port = 5672
peer = ulaix.sivrelworks.internal
salt = 1df570ed
pin = 6327

Ticket QV-1182: CSV wizard credentials vault locked

The Mapleshard import wizard can't reach its column-mapping templates because the Ossuary vault auto-locked after three failed rotations. Imports queue but never complete. For the weekly sync: fix is to reseal and reopen the vault before Thursday's batch window. Reopening requires the recovery passphrase below.

strongbox words: gilok-druion-briath-wendor-briion-prawyn-fenion-oliir-casdor-holius-briius-gilath-gilael-pelys

Hi night crew — quick one from the front desk at Dunmore Yard. The first-aid room next to the loading bay got restocked today, so the old supplies box is gone. If anyone needs it overnight, it's no longer on the master fob — the door now runs on a keypad. Use the code below.

staff pass of tajof-fawif = bdg-CW-8